This Travel Radiation Therapist position in Reading, PA requires BLS from AHA, PA fingerprints, and experience with Varian equipment. You will administer radiation treatments according to the prescription authorized by the radiation oncologist. Responsibilities include obtaining images for planning and targeting, assessing patient condition prior to simulation and treatment, and providing ongoing patient education throughout the course of simulation and treatment. When assigned to CT simulation, you will create immobilization and treatment aid devices, operate a CT scanner and MED RAD power injector for IV contrast, obtain and analyze cross-sectional imaging for treatment planning, and perform blood draws as indicated. Travel Radiation Therapist jobs in St Johnsbury, VT let you treat patients using various radiation therapy modalities and maintain detailed treatment records. 5×8 schedule The role would provide coverage to both the Lebanon Main Campus (New Hampshire) and St Johnsbury (Vermont) locations. The clinics are an hour apart, and the traveler would have a minimum 4 weeks’ notice of which location they are scheduled You’ll observe patient responses, screen and direct physical and emotional concerns to the radiation oncologist or nurse, and prepare daily schedules for treatment machines. Responsibilities include verifying patient data, presenting field verification films to physicians, adjusting fields as directed, and preparing dose calculations while maintaining accurate billing. Required qualifications are Radiologic Technologist certification in Radiation Therapy, ARRT(T), NH and VT state licenses, and BLS certification. Radiation Therapist needed asap Marin Health Medical Center is seeking one 13 weeks Radiotherapy Technologist to support our Radiation Oncology department. This position is 5 x 8hrs (Monday through Friday) day shift with 0700 – 0800 start time. Interested candidates must have the following skills and experience: 3 years of minimum Radiation Oncology experience. Properly setup and align patients using various imaging techniques to delivery radiation therapy treatments as prescribed. Assesses patient status during direct patient interaction and makes appropriate referrals to various health care team members. Prepares for treatment delivery, including chart/film checks, room set-up, calculations, electronic medical record (MOSAIQ) check, treatment calendar (including programming port films etc.). Performs patient set-up and CT scan for radiation therapy treatment planning purposes, as needed. Works closely with other radiation therapists and team members to perform additional tasks, as needed. Experience with Varian TrueBeam and/or MOSAIQ preferred. Must have ARRT and CA RTT license, as well as BLS cert.
